Section Carving is a complex and difficult art to master. Defined as carving the subject from the same stone in one piece, the master carver must know not only other carving techniques, but also the intricacies of the gemstone. Some inclusion or fault may not be visible until the carving is underway. The carver must then be prepared to alter the design immediately. Usually a sketch is drawn before the carving is begun, with alternate drawings to refer to should unexpected weak spots appear. While it takes 8-10 years to become a master carver, another 3 years or more are required to become proficient in section carving.
